ABSTRACT:
This paper gives information about automation of process plant based on PLC&SCADA. In this plant ammonia
is separated from industrial sludge to protect environment from pollution. The objective of this project is to
convert the manually operated plant to fully automated plant for achieving higher accuracy, efficiency and time
saving. Project uses PLC & configuration software to collect various intelligent instruments on site and
electrical parameters of devices and SCADA for monitoring plant.

The process control of distillation which is the most important process in any plant like color industries and its automation
is the precise effort of this paper. In order to automate a plant and minimize human intervention, there is a need to develop
a SCADA (supervisory control and data acquisition) system that monitors the plant and helps to reduce the errors caused
by humans [3]. While the SCADA is used to monitor the system, PLC (programmable logic controller)is also used for the
internal storage of instruction for the implementing function such as logic, sequencing, timing, counting and arithmetic to
control through digital or analog input/ output modules various types of machines processes [3]. Systems are used to
monitor and control a plant or equipment in industries such as telecommunications, water and waste control, energy, oil
and gas refining and transportation[3].
Plant process
In our project distillation process is used for separation of ammonia from industrial sludge. Ammonia is separated to
decrease the hazardness of ammonia from the sludge to save the environment from the pollution.
Control parameters in process
Flow control
Pressure control
Temperature control
Level control
Pressure difference control

CONCLUSIONS
By using automation based on PLC &SCADA we can increase productivity & replace humans in task done in
dangerous environment. Benefit of replacing human in plant reduce operation time & increase consistency of output.
